Core appraisal service

Independent evaluation of the amount of property loss

When estimates differ, a useful appraisal review looks beyond the final totals and identifies the scope, quantity, pricing, and repair-method differences behind them.

The appraisal assignment can include review of the damaged property, measurements, photographs, competing estimates, repair sequencing, material considerations, labor, access, and other information that affects the cost of repair.

  • Review of the applicable appraisal provision
  • Inspection and property-specific loss documentation
  • Comparison of competing repair scopes and estimates
  • Supported position concerning the amount of loss

What is included in a property insurance appraisal service?

The scope depends on the assignment and policy, but it may include document review, property inspection, measurements, damage evaluation, estimate comparison, pricing review, and development of a supported position concerning the amount of loss.

Can you prepare both Xactimate and Symbility estimates?

Yes. Detailed line-item estimating can be prepared using Xactimate or Symbility when the selected platform is appropriate for the assignment.

Is Matterport required for every property claim?

No. Matterport is one available documentation tool. Whether it is useful depends on the property, loss conditions, required measurements, and goals of the assignment.

Do you work on both residential and commercial losses?

Yes. Services can support homes, condominiums, rental properties, retail buildings, offices, multi-family properties, churches, and other commercial or institutional buildings.

What documents should I provide?

Helpful records may include the applicable appraisal provision, carrier and contractor estimates, photographs, measurements, engineering reports, invoices, repair proposals, and relevant claim correspondence.

Does an appraisal decide insurance coverage?

Appraisal generally focuses on valuation or the amount of loss. Coverage questions remain subject to the insurance policy, claim facts, and applicable law.
